app.vue 引入了公共组件footer

footer组件因为渲染较快,首屏进入时,会出现先加载出来的情况,这种情况怎么解决啊

阅读 2k
2 个回答
  1. 加载蒙板
  2. 骨架屏

延迟加载啊,比如你要等待 xxx组件mouted之后再加载footer的话,就可以设置一个加载状态标识,在xxx组件挂载完成之后,更新状态,然后渲染footer。

再简单粗暴点,直接使用setTimeout控制状态更新

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题